The Development of Life’s Systems
Many systems form: nerve system, cardiovascular, endocrine, reproductive, digestive, skeletal, muscular, and several others. Which one do you think forms first? Many people answer “the heart,” which actually makes sense. You need blood pumping to develop! The correct answer is actually the nerve system. In fact, the nerve system begins to form only EIGHTEEN days after those two tiny cells get together. Most women don’t even know they’re pregnant when their baby’s brain has begun to form.
Why the Nerve System Comes First
Now why does the nerve system form first? Why not the heart? Because the nerve system, composed of the brain, spinal cord, and all the nerves in the body, is like the orchestra conductor. It coordinates all the other systems. It tells your heart to beat, your lungs to breathe, your stomach to digest, along with every other function in your body.
